A Herbst Home appliance is an orthopedic device that aids modify growth in a handy way. Unlike a headwear, which is detachable, the Herbst Home appliance is cemented in place. It holds the reduced jaw in an ahead position to aid make best use of lower jaw development capacity. Although a person's reduced jaw is located onward a bit while putting on a Herbst device, she or he has the ability to open & close as well as relocate their mouth around in a typical method.

Some even use tooth-colored cords to be also much less obvious. In 1979, Dr. George Andreasen created a new method of fixing braces with the use of the Nitinol cords since they had super-elasticity. Andreason made use of the cable on some patients as well as later on discovered that he might use it for the entire treatment. In the early 20th century, Edward Angle developed the very first easy classification system for malocclusions, such as Class I, Course II, and so on. His classification system is still utilized today as a means for dental professionals to describe just how crooked teeth are, what method teeth are aiming, as well as just how teeth fit together. Angle added greatly to the design of orthodontic and also oral devices, making many simplifications.

Separators are small rubber bands that are utilized to make room between the back teeth prior to getting braces. These are utilized between molars that require to have steel bands placed around them. In order to make area for the density of the band, we need to place separators in between your teeth for about a week. The separators somewhat press the teeth apart so bands can be fit around them.
